Has anyone else tried this ?

It's supposed to impart colour and shine but even though I used what I thought was a reasonable amount, it left my hair greasy, lank and stuck together. I may just have well stuck my head in the chip pan and saved myself £6.95.

You put it on after shampoo & conditioner, leave for 3 mins, then rinse out .... and I could tell straight away that my hair felt strange even though I rinsed for ages.

Would be interested to hear what anyone else thinks ..... am just off to complain to them.
